Ship’s Steward Training

This training program is designed to equip individuals with the skills and knowledge necessary to work as a ship's steward. The course covers a wide range of topics related to housekeeping, laundry, and passenger service.

  • Develop housekeeping skills: Participants will learn how to clean and maintain various areas of the ship, including cabins, public spaces, and offices.
  • Learn laundry techniques: Participants will learn how to operate laundry equipment, sort laundry, and ensure proper care of linens and clothing.
  • Provide excellent customer service: Participants will learn how to provide exceptional service to passengers and crew members.
  • Understand maritime regulations: Participants will understand and comply with maritime regulations related to safety, hygiene, and passenger service.
  • Work effectively in a team environment: Participants will learn how to work collaboratively with other ship staff to ensure the smooth operation of the vessel.
